The median property tax (also known as real estate tax) in Warrick County is $1,120.00 per year, based on a median home value of $140,200.00 and a median effective property tax rate of 0.80% of property value.

Warrick County collects relatively low property taxes, and is ranked in the bottom half of all counties in the United States by property tax collections. Of the ninety-two counties in Indiana, Warrick County is ranked 15th by median property taxes, and 50th by median tax as percentage of home value.

Warrick County's higher property taxes are partially due to property values, as the median home value in Warrick County is $140,200.00. For comparison, the state-wide median property value is $123,100.00

Warrick County Property Tax Assessor

Property tax assessments in Warrick County are the responsibility of the Warrick County Tax Assessor, whose office is located in Boonville, Indiana.

If you need to pay your property tax bill, ask about a property tax assessment, look up the Warrick County property tax due date, or find property tax records, visit the Warrick County Tax Assessor's page. Applications for the Warrick County homestead exemption, any property tax appeals, and applications for a current use tax reduction must also be submitted to the Warrick County Assessor's Office.
